CVE-2017-16803

7.5 · HIGH
Published Nov 13, 2017 libav CWE-119 EPSS 3.01% (86th pctl)

Overview

CVE-2017-16803 is a high-severity vulnerability affecting libav libav. It was published on November 13, 2017 and has a CVSS 3.0 base score of 7.5 (HIGH).

This vulnerability has a CVSS 3.0 base score of 7.5, rated HIGH. It can be exploited remotely over the network. No authentication or special privileges are required for exploitation.

Technical Description

In Libav through 11.11 and 12.x through 12.1, the smacker_decode_tree function in libavcodec/smacker.c does not properly restrict tree recursion, which allows remote attackers to cause a denial of service (bitstream.c:build_table() out-of-bounds read and application crash) via a crafted Smacker stream.
